At 9:30 p.m. onThursday, the22nd of March, the oil tanker ExxonValdez left the oil terminal atYaldez, Alaska, loaded with I .26 mlllion barrels of oil. The Valdez was the largest tanker owned by Exxon. It was nearly 1,000 feet long and weighed, fully loaded, 280,000 tons.

When the ship left port, it was under the command of Captain William Murphy, the harbor pilot. Harbor pilots are responsible for steering both incoming and outgo- ing tankers through the Valdez Narrows, a lr-mtle-wide approach to the port of Valdez. After exiting the Narrows and achieving the sea lanes in Prince William Sound Captain Murphy turned over command to Captain Joseph Hazelwood and left the ship. Captain Murphy testified later that he had smelled alcohol on the breath of Captain Hazelwood, but that he made no comment and took no action. He knew that it was common practice for both the officers and crew of oil tankers to drink while in port.

Captain Hazelwood, immediately after assuming command" radioed the Coast Guard and requested permission to alter course to avoid large chunks of ice that had broken loose from the Columbia Glacier and were floating in the outbound shipping lane. The

permission was granted. captain Hazelwood then turned over command of the vessel toThird Mate Gregory cousins and went below to his cabin. Mr. cousins was not licensedto pilot a ship in the sea channels approaching Yaldez. Mr. Cousins and others latertestified that it was common practice to turn ou., ,o-mand of oil tankers to nonli- censed officers' Captain Hazelwood had set the automatic pilot to steer the ship south-ward into the inbound shipping lane, and he had instructed Mr. cousins to maintainthe course until after the ice chunks from the glacier were passed and then to returnnorthward to the outbound lane. No inbound trarric was expected and permission forthis course change had been granted by the coast Guard, so no danger was anticipated.At 11:55 Mr. cousins ordered a course change of 10 degrees right rudder to bring thetanker back to the proper lane within the channel. There *u, no response. At 12:04the lookout, who

YT- on the bridge rather than atthe normal station on the bow of thetanker, sighted the lighted buoy marketing Bligh Reef, a rock outcropping only 30 to 40feet beneath the surface. Mr. cousins ordered-...r..g.rr.y hard right rudder. Again there

was no response' In the hearing that followed the accident, it was determined that eithercaptain Hazelwood had not informed Mr. cousins that he had placed the ship on auto-matic pilot, or that Mr. cousins and the helmsman had not remembered to disconnect the automatic pilot, which prevented manual steering of the vessel.

At 12:05 a'm' the Exxon Yardezran aground on Bligh Reef. The hull was punctured in numerous places, and,260,000 barrels, approximatety t1,000,000 gallons of crudeoil, spilled from the badly ruptured tanks. It was the largest oil spill in the history of theNorth American petroleum industry. -r

At 12:28 a.m' one of the officers on the ship radioed to the coast Guard that it was aground on Bligh Reef. 'Are you leaking oil?'l a Coast Guard operator asked. ,,I think so," was the reply.

At 3:28 a.m. members of the Coast Guard boarded the Exxon valdez and reported that oil was gushing from the tanker. "'We've got a serious problem,,,radioed the Coast Guard officer on board the tanker. "There's nouody here. . . . where,s Alyeska?,,

'Alyeska" was the Alyeska Pipeline Service Cimpany, which both managed the oilpipeline that brought crude oil 800 miles from the oil ri.ld, at prudhoe Bay to Valdez and ran the oil terminal atYaldez.It was responsible, through a formal agreement withthe state of Alaska' for the containment and recovery of alioii spills within the harbor and sea lanes. That agreement was expressed in a deiailed writte; plan, 250 pages long, that listed the equipment and personnel that were to be kept available by Alyeska, and the actions that were to be taken by Alyesk a, to reactpromptiy to oil spills. . The stated goal of the written plan was to encircL any serious oil spill with float-ing containment booms within five hours of the first report of the occurrence, and to recover 50 percent of the spill within 48 hours. The stated goal was well known within the atea, and accounted for the perplexity of the coast Guard officer. when he reported, "There's nobody here," he was referring not to the captain and crew of the tanker, but to the oil spill recovery team and equipment from Alyeska.

The coast Guard officer also noted the smeli of alcohol on the breath of Captain Hazelwood, and reported to his base in very blunt terms that he suspected the captain was drunk' He was unabie to establish the i.gr.. of intoxication, due to the lack of atesting kit, but he did request the assistarrr. o1the Alaska State police to conduct thetests as soon as possible. Those tests were conducted the following morning, and did

The causes of the accident, while obviously related to the intoxication of the captainand the subsequent command of the ship by an unlicensed third mate, were thought to bemore complex thanthatsimple explanation. TWo additional factors were mentioned in theearly hearings of the Federal Transportation safety Board that investigated the oil spill. ' Tired crew members' The crew members on the tanker were said to have beenexhausted from working long hours, and not fully alert. The Exxon valdeznormally

carried a crew of 20 persons. This crew size was ctnsidered to be typical for crude oiltankers, but it was substantially smaller than that required by coast Guard regulations and union requirements on merchant cargo ships. The oil cornpanies had argued thatthe new technologies automated the operations of the tankers u.rd.li-inated the needfor a larger crew- The modern equipment, however, had to be manned and maintained, and consequently the automation did not keep the officers and crew from workingextensive amounts of overtime and frequently going long stretches with little or nosleep' crew members on the Exxon valdez tesiifled that they had worked an aver-age of 140 hours of overtime per month per person for the six months prior to theaccident' one hundred and forty hours of ou.riime per month and,20 days at sea permonth plus the regular g-hour watches works out to be 15 hours per day.

Many of the crew members were exhausted, a routine feeling on Exxon ships, theytestified. (The NewyorkTimes,May 22,19g9, p. 10)2

In fairness to Exxon, it should be explained that company officials felt that publicreactions to the oil spill were extreme and did not take inio account several mitigatingfactors' First, they thought that the public did not rearly understand that the companycould not be held responsible for the intoxication of captain Hazelwood. Second, theythought that the public did not fully reali ze thatthe company had been prevented fromusing chemical dispersants on the oil. chemical dispersants, it should be understood, do not destroy the oil. Instead, theeffect of the dispersant is to lower the surface tension of the oil to the point where itwill break up and disperse in the water in the form of tiny droplets. The problem is thatthese tiny droplets are in a size range that is easily ingested by marine organisms on thelower end of the marine food chain, and therefore graduarly impact marine creatureson the higher end of that chain. The extent of that impact has never been studied underall climatic conditions' It is known that dispersants make an oil spill much less visible;there is no certainty that they make it any less toxic.

Despite the lack of certainty about the effect of the dispersants, company officialsthought that chemicals should have been used as soon as it was apparentthat the con-tainment and recovery efforts had failed, and before the beaches were fouled and thewildlife kilied' Mr' Rawl, the chairman of Exxon, in an interview with Fortune maga-zine' said environmentalists acting with the state of Alaska had prevented the companyfrom applying the dispersants prolptly:

But in the view of the government in Washington, there was no excuse for the inability first ofAlyeska and then of Exxon to deal promptly and effectively with the spill itself.

The contingency plan that had been developed by Alyeska and approved by the state of Alaska envisaged containment within five hours and recovery of a minimum of 50 percent of the oil by skimmers within 48 hours. Containment, as stated previously took 59 hours, and estimates of the amount of oil actually recovered ranged from 0.4 to 2.5 percent. A number of reasons for the ineffectiveness of the response by Alyeska and Exxon were given in hearings held by the National Transportation Safety Board.

It should be explained before discussing the results of these hearings before the National Transportation Safety Board that the Alyeska Pipelines Service Company is not a subsidiary of the Exxon Corporation. It is a consortium owned by the seven oil companies that have drilling rights on the North Slope ofAlaska and ship crude oil from Prudhoe Bay to YaIdez. Representatives of all seven companies serve on the board of directors. Exxon is the second largest owner, and is said to participate actively in the management of the company.

The first reason given for the slowness of response was a shortage of equipment. The oil spill contingency plan required Alyeska to maintain two barges, loaded with contain- ment booms and ready for use. At the time of the spill, only one barge was available. The other had been scrapped as old and obsolete, but its replacement was still in Seattle. There was a requirement in the contingency plan that Alyeska notif' the state Depart- ment of Environmental Conservation if any equipment was out of service for any period of time. Alyeska now concedes that it failed to provide this notification.

The barge that was available had been damaged by a storm in January. It was still considered to be seaworthy, but the containment booms had been unloaded to facilitate repair. Repairs had been delayed, according to testimony by Alyeska officials, because the company had been unable to locate a licensed marine welder. Environmentalists at the hearing displayed the Valdez telephone book that listed four companies that claimed to provide licensed marine welding services.

Seven thousand one hundred feet of containment booms were stored at the oil terminal. The contingency plan did not specifu an exact lineal footage that was to be kept in stock, but it can be understood that 7,100 feet would be enough to contain a spill around a 1,000 foot tanker only if the booms could be placed quickly, before the oil spread out upon the surface of the water. Three thousand feet would be required just to encircle the hull.

Ten skimmers, which are Iarge suction units that can be mounted on barges and used in essence to vacuum oil from the surface of the sea, were available as promised in the contingency plan. However, replacement parts were not kept in stock, and equip- ment breakdowns were common as the machines were not designed to work on the emulsified mixture of oil and water that was formed rapidly through wave actions on the noncontained spill.

Other equipment that was needed either was missing or could not be found quickly. Heary ship fenders, essential for the second tanker to come alongside the Exxon Valdez and pump out its remaining oil, couldn't be located for hours because they were buried under 74 feet of snow. Half of the required six-inch hose, needed for the pumping, never

In addition to the shortage of equipment, there was also a shortage of personnel. The oil spill contingency plan required Alyeska to have a crew of 15 persons on duty atall times' These were not oil spili experts. These were hourly paid workers responsible for the normal operations of the terminal, but according to the plan they should haveincluded all of the skills and trades necessary to respond to emergencies, whether oilspills at sea, oii leaks on iand, or oil fires at the terminal.

At the time of the spill, only 1 I workers were on duty. Unfortunately, none of thosepeople knew how to operate the crane, which was needed to load the barge with thelong and heavy containment booms. A crane operator was finally located, but he was also the only one who knew how to drive the fork lift, and he spent the morning afterthe accident, when speed in response was essential, running back and forth between thefork lift and the loading crane.

Last' there was a lack of training. Alyeska had dismissed its oil spill response teamin 1981' This was a group of 12 persons originally set up to contain and then clean up spills throughoutYaldez Harbor and Prince wiliiam Sound. The duties of the spill response team were assigned to regular employees at the plant. At the time of dismissal, Alyeska had claimed that this arrangement would be superior as they would have,,l20 people trained in oil spill response rather than 12.,,

The shortage of equipment, the shortage of personnel, and the lack of training were

caused, it now appears, by deliberate policy decisions reached by the senior manage- ment of Exxon Corporation, who pushed strongly for cost reductions at Alyeska during

the mid-1980s. These policy decisions were not taken arbitrarily. They were in response

to a change in the basic economic conditions of the oil industry. Oil prices fell from $32lbarrel in 1981, at the height of the power of the OPEC

(Organization of Petroleum Exporting Countries) to $ I2harcel in 1987, and then rose slightly to stabilize in the range of $ 15 to $20lbarrel. The large oil companies are verti-

cally integrated, with divisions for the exploration, production, and refining of crude

oil, and for the distribution and marketing of oil products. The lower price for crude oil brought exploration nearly to a halt and severely reduced the profits that come from

production. The large, vertically integrated oil companies reacted slowly to the changed eco-

nomic conditions, but the reaction-when it came-was dramatic and harsh. Costs were reduced. Employees were discharged. The changes at Exxon were particularly dra-

matic because the company for years had prided itself on a generous, almost paternal

attitude towards its employees. In January 1986 Mr. Clifton Garvin, chairman of Exxon

Corporation since Ig7 5, commente d to Fortune magazine about personnel policies at

the time of his company's selection as one of the 10 "most admired" firms in the United

States.

Six months later, Exxon Corporation was in the midst of an extensive restructuring

effort that would eventually change the company from one of the "most admired" to one

of the most disliked. The company plann ed a 2 percent budget cut. They gave workers

60 days to decide whether or not to resign with their partially funded pensions. It added

that if it did not get enough volunteers, it would resort to involuntary terminations, with no pensions. Analysts estimated that the 26 percent budget cut, almost totally aimed at

mid-level managers and hourly paid workers, would reduce employment approximately

one-third. The generous, almost paternal attitude of the company toward Exxon employees had

disappeared. Nearly one-third of all the company's workers, almost all of those over 50 years of age, were told they had to retire early or be fired:
